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40350843539 817484648 705898
6783273183 891 99386086
6783273183 891 99386086
416055 1057 26952652734
All about undefined
Interested in learning more?
6783273183 891 99386086
416055 1057 26952652734
See more
47414699812 217409 32644141
37405884 5547865000 4749
See more
0248596743 53353994211
604662 74910954 2345622
See more